The Automobile Check Valve is an important component used in automobile engines and fuel systems. Its main function is to ensure that the fluid can only flow in one direction to prevent backflow or reflux. This valve controls the one-way flow of the fluid through a built-in spring or gravity mechanism and is often used in fuel lines, cooling systems, and other places where backflow needs to be prevented. It can not only effectively protect the engine and other key components from backflow but also improve the efficiency and safety of the system. The pneumatic brake valve is a key component that uses compressed air to control and regulate the brake system. It is widely used in pneumatic brake systems of automobiles, railways, engineering machinery and industrial equipment. Its core function is to achieve braking, release, holding, and regulation functions by accurately regulating air pressure to ensure the safety and stability of the system under various operating conditions. The pneumatic brake valve is made of high-strength alloy or corrosion-resistant material, with excellent pressure resistance, sealing and durability to adapt to high-frequency operations and complex working conditions. Its internal structure is precisely designed to respond quickly to changes in air pressure to ensure the reliability and consistency of braking action.

ALL ProductsThe Engineering machinery rubber products include both pure rubber parts and metal-bonded rubber parts, designed for a wide range of automotive and industrial applications. Pure rubber parts are made from high-quality rubber materials, providing excellent flexibility, shock absorption, and resistance to wear, heat, and chemicals. These components are essential for sealing, vibration isolation, and cushioning within automotive systems. On the other hand, metal-bonded rubber parts combine the flexibility of rubber with the strength and durability of metal, offering superior resistance to mechanical stress, high temperatures, and harsh environments. These hybrid components are often used in critical automotive applications where both flexibility and strength are required.
